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x13-inch baking dish with butter or cooking spray, then dust with flour.
- In a medium-sized mixing b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, baking powder, and salt until well combined.
- In a large mixing bowl, beat together softened unsalted but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y, then add eggs one at a time.
- Stir in vanilla extract, then gradually mix in the dry ingredients and whole milk alternately, starting and ending with dry ingredients.
-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Allow the cake to cool completely in the pan on a wire rack.
- In a separate bowl, combine sweetened condensed milk, evaporated milk, and heavy cream, whisking until smooth.
- Poke holes all over the top of the cooled cake and pour the milk mixture evenly over the cake, then refrigerate for at least 2 hours.
- Top with diced ripe mango and whipped cream; garnish with fresh mint leaves if desired.
